Former #NWSL Portland Thorns coach (who also coached Canada’s youth national teams and had a career playing in Winnipeg) and former NWSL and Canada national team player Desi Scott (aka “The Destroyer”) are co-founders of Winnipeg’s new (not yet named) Northern Super League franchise. Desi Scott will be Vice President, Community & Player Experience and Rob Gale will be Chief Sporting Officer of the new club that will play its first season in the #NSL next year (2027). https://www.nsl.ca/new...

Something I didn’t know about Canada: only 1/4 of Canadians get their mail delivered directly to their door. So if you live in a house and have your mail delivered to a mailbox next to your front entrance you are in the minority. In the next 5 years 4 million addresses will switch to shared mailboxes (like we apartment building residents have in the entrance lobby or like in rural areas where there’s a cluster of mailboxes when you enter town). https://www.cbc.ca/news/politics/canada-post-doo...

“The Confederation of African Football (CAF) has continued its ongoing investment campaign into women’s football across the continent. The latest roll-out has seen 80 officials in African women’s football undergo training on topics including leadership and strategic planning.” https://herfootballhub.com/caf-invests-in-efforts-womens-football-improve-leadership-africa/
